Put the soda, salt and cream of tartar into the dry flour.
Rub in the lard and mix with water into a soft dough.
Roll to the size of the spider or griddle.
When the spider is hot and well greased with lard, lay on the cake and cover.
Bake ten minutes on one side, then ten on the other.
Serve hot with butter.
This can be made quickly without waiting for the oven to heat.
